#8eb4f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8eb4f2 is composed of 55.7% red, 70.6%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 25.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 217.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 75.3%. #8eb4f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1d69e5.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#8eb4f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8eb4f2 has RGB values of R:142, G:180,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 9352434.

Shades and Tints of #8eb4f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050a is the darkest color, while #f8f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8eb4f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bec0c2 is the less saturated color, while #84b2fc is the most saturated one.
